What is Motion Graphics and Animation Services?

Motion graphics and animation services focus on creating moving visuals to tell a story, convey information, or promote a product. These services are essential in industries ranging from advertising to education. Think of motion graphics as combining graphic design with animation to produce engaging content that captivates an audience. Animation, on the other hand, involves creating motion through a series of still images. Together, they can create compelling narratives and enhance viewer engagement.

  • Motion graphics often involve text and basic shapes that animate to illustrate a concept.
  • Animation can range from 2D cartoon-style visuals to 3D renderings of complex objects.
  • Both forms are widely used in commercials, explainer videos, and social media content.

Step-by-Step Guide to Creating Motion Graphics and Animation

Your Motion Graphics and Animation Action Plan

Step 1

Define Your Goal

Start by identifying what you want to achieve with your motion graphics or animation. Are you aiming to inform, entertain, or promote? This goal will guide your creative process.

  • Consider your target audience and what resonates with them.
  • Make sure your goal aligns with your overall marketing strategy.
Step 2

Develop a Script

A well-thought-out script is crucial. It should outline the key messages you want to convey and the flow of the video. Keep it concise to maintain viewer interest.

  • Use bullet points to simplify complex information.
  • Test your script with a small audience to gather feedback.
Step 3

Storyboarding

Create a storyboard that visually represents each scene. This helps in visualizing how the motion graphics will unfold and ensures everything aligns with your script.

  • Use sketches or digital tools to outline scenes.
  • Include notes on transitions and animations.
Step 4

Choose the Right Tools

Select software that suits your skill level and project requirements. Tools like Adobe After Effects, Blender, and Toon Boom Harmony are popular choices.

  • Consider trial versions to find the best fit.
  • Look for tutorials to get started with your chosen tool.
Step 5

Animation and Motion Design

Begin animating your graphics based on your storyboard. Pay attention to timing, transitions, and effects to create a smooth viewing experience.

  • Test animations frequently to ensure they flow well.
  • Incorporate sound effects and music to enhance the experience.
Step 6

Review and Revise

Gather feedback from peers or a test audience. Use their insights to make necessary adjustments to improve clarity and engagement.

  • Focus on areas that may confuse viewers.
  • Be open to constructive criticism.
Step 7

Launch and Promote

Once you're satisfied with the final product, it's time to share it with the world! Promote it across your social media platforms, website, and email newsletters.

  • Utilize analytics tools to track engagement.
  • Consider using paid ads to boost visibility.

Pros and Cons of Motion Graphics and Animation Services

✅ Pros

  • Increased Engagement

    Motion graphics can significantly boost viewer engagement. For instance, videos with animations are shared 1200% more than text and images combined, making them a powerful tool for marketing.

  • Versatility

    These services can be applied across various industries, from healthcare to entertainment. They can deliver complex information in a digestible format, making them invaluable for explainer videos.

  • Creative Expression

    Motion graphics and animation allow for an immense amount of creative freedom. You can design unique characters and stories that align with your brand's voice, fostering a deeper connection with your audience.

❌ Cons

  • Cost Considerations

    High-quality motion graphics and animations can be costly. Hiring skilled animators or purchasing software licenses may stretch your budget, especially for small businesses.

  • Time-Consuming Process

    Creating motion graphics and animations can be time-consuming. Developing a concept, script, and storyboards, and then producing the final product can take weeks or even months.

  • Potential for Miscommunication

    If not executed well, motion graphics can confuse viewers rather than clarify. It's essential to ensure that the animations effectively communicate the intended message.

Common Mistakes to Avoid in Motion Graphics and Animation

Even seasoned professionals can make mistakes when creating motion graphics and animations. Here are some common pitfalls to watch out for:

  • Overcomplicating the Design: While it can be tempting to showcase every feature, too much detail can overwhelm viewers. Focus on the core message.
  • Ineffective Use of Color: Color choices can greatly impact viewer perception. Make sure to use colors that align with your brand and evoke the desired emotions.
  • Neglecting Audio Elements: Sound effects and music can enhance your animation. Neglecting this aspect can make the visuals feel incomplete or disconnected.
  • Ignoring Call-to-Actions: Every animation should guide viewers toward a specific action. Failing to include clear calls-to-action can result in missed opportunities.
  • Skipping the Planning Phase: Jumping straight into production without a solid plan can lead to miscommunication and wasted resources. Always start with a clear strategy.

Motion Graphics and Animation Tools Comparison Table

Tool/Platform Key Features Pricing Best For Pros Cons
Adobe After Effects Offers advanced animation tools, extensive plugins, and integration with Adobe Creative Suite. Subscription-based pricing starting at $20.99/month. Best for professional animators and motion graphic designers. Highly versatile, great community support, and extensive learning resources. Can be overwhelming for beginners due to its complexity.
Blender 3D modeling, sculpting, animation, and rendering capabilities. Free and open-source. Best for those interested in 3D animation and modeling. Completely free with a large community and extensive tutorials. Steep learning curve for new users.
Toon Boom Harmony Industry-standard for 2D animation, offering a robust feature set for frame-by-frame and rig-based animations. Pricing starts at $25/month for the Essentials version. Best for professional 2D animators and studios. High-quality animation tools and excellent for character animation. Can be pricey for individual users.

Motion Graphics and Animation Timeline

Pre-production
🔹
In this phase, you define your goals, develop a script, and create a storyboard.
Activities:
  • Brainstorming ideas and defining the project's purpose.
  • Drafting and refining the script.
  • Creating a visual storyboard to map out scenes.
Deliverables:
  • Finalized script and storyboard.
  • Concept sketches or mood boards.
Production
🔹
This phase involves the actual creation of the animation or motion graphics based on the storyboard.
Activities:
  • Animating scenes based on the storyboard.
  • Incorporating sound effects and music.
  • Reviewing animations for consistency.
Deliverables:
  • Draft version of the animation.
  • Initial audio mix.
Post-production
🔹
In this final phase, you review, revise, and prepare the animation for launch.
Activities:
  • Gathering feedback from test audiences.
  • Making final adjustments based on reviews.
  • Preparing the final version for distribution.
Deliverables:
  • Final animation file.
  • Distribution plan for sharing the content.

Beginner Tips for Motion Graphics and Animation

If you’re just starting with motion graphics and animation, here are some tips to help you get off on the right foot:

  • Start with Simple Projects: Begin with small, manageable projects to build your skills and confidence. This could be as simple as creating a short animated logo or a basic infographic.
  • Learn the Basics of Animation: Familiarize yourself with key concepts like timing, spacing, and easing. Understanding these principles will greatly improve your animations.
  • Utilize Online Tutorials: There are countless resources available online, from YouTube tutorials to paid courses on platforms like Skillshare and Udemy. Take advantage of these to learn new skills.
  • Join a Community: Engaging with other animators can provide support and inspiration. Look for forums, social media groups, or local meetups where you can connect with like-minded individuals.
  • Seek Feedback: Don’t hesitate to share your work with others and ask for constructive criticism. This can help you identify areas for improvement and refine your skills.

Advanced Tips for Mastering Motion Graphics and Animation

If you’re looking to elevate your motion graphics and animation skills, here are some advanced tips:

  • Experiment with Styles: Don’t limit yourself to one style. Experiment with different animation techniques, such as frame-by-frame, 2D, and 3D animation to find your unique voice.
  • Master Your Software: Invest time in mastering your animation software. Learn the shortcuts and advanced features to improve your workflow and productivity.
  • Focus on Storytelling: Strong narratives can elevate your animations. Think about how your visuals can tell a story and keep the audience engaged throughout.
  • Incorporate User Feedback: As you grow, consistently seek feedback from your audience. Use analytics tools to measure engagement and refine your content based on viewer preferences.
  • Keep Learning: The world of motion graphics and animation is always evolving. Stay updated on trends and new techniques by following industry leaders and attending workshops or webinars.
